Enhanced Mental Health with Virtual Reality Mental Hygiene by a Veteran Suffering from PTSD.
Bo Søndergaard JensenNiels AndersenJes PetersenLene NyboePublished in: Case reports in psychiatry (2021)
This paper describes the application and feasibility of the use of Virtual Reality Mental Hygiene (VRMH) as a mean to reduce anxiety and stress in a Danish veteran suffering from posttraumatic stress disorder (PTSD) and enduring personality change after a catastrophic experience. The results from this case study provide preliminary evidence that VRMH can be used as a mean to reduce arousal in patients with severe PTSD.
